Document.SendFaxOverInternet Метод (2007 System)
Обновлен: Ноябрь 2007
Отправляет документ поставщику службы факсов, который отправляет документ как факс одному или нескольким указанным получателям.
Пространство имен: Microsoft.Office.Tools.Word
Сборка: Microsoft.Office.Tools.Word.v9.0 (в Microsoft.Office.Tools.Word.v9.0.dll)
Синтаксис
'Декларация
Public Sub SendFaxOverInternet ( _
ByRef Recipients As Object, _
ByRef Subject As Object, _
ByRef ShowMessage As Object _
)
'Применение
Dim instance As Document
Dim Recipients As Object
Dim Subject As Object
Dim ShowMessage As Object
instance.SendFaxOverInternet(Recipients, _
Subject, ShowMessage)
public void SendFaxOverInternet(
ref Object Recipients,
ref Object Subject,
ref Object ShowMessage
)
Параметры
- Recipients
Тип: System.Object%
Номера факса и адреса электронной почты пользователей, которым необходимо отправить факс. Несколько получателей отделяются друг от друга точкой с запятой.
- Subject
Тип: System.Object%
Строка темы для документа, отправляемого по факсу.
- ShowMessage
Тип: System.Object%
Значение true — отображение факсимильного сообщения перед отправкой. Значение false — отправка факса без отображения факсимильного сообщения.
Заметки
Для использования этого метода необходимо, чтобы на компьютере пользователя была включена служба факсов. Если служба факсов недоступна, метод SendFaxOverInternet создает исключение.
Для указания номеров факса в параметре Recipients используется либо формат recipientsfaxnumber@usersfaxprovider, либо формат recipientsname@recipientsfaxnumber. Доступ к сведениям о поставщике факсов пользователя можно получить в следующем разделе реестра:
HKEY_CURRENT_USER\Software\Microsoft\Office\11.0\Common\Services\Fax
Следует использовать значение FaxAddress ключа в данном расположении реестра, чтобы определить формат, который необходимо использовать для пользователя. Если данная запись реестра не существует, служба факса недоступна.
Необязательные параметры
Сведения о необязательных параметрах см. в разделе Общие сведения о необязательных параметрах в решениях Office.
Примеры
В приведенном ниже примере кода метод SendFaxOverInternet используется для отправки документа на номер факса в формате recipientsfaxnumber@usersfaxprovider. Затем в коде перед отправкой факса выводится документ.
В этом примере демонстрируется настройка уровня документа.
Private Sub DocumentSendFaxOverInternet()
Me.SendFaxOverInternet("14255550101@consolidatedmessenger.com", _
"For your review.", True)
End Sub
private void DocumentSendFaxOverInternet()
{
object recipients = "14255550101@consolidatedmessenger.com";
object subject = "For your review.";
object showMessage = true;
this.SendFaxOverInternet(ref recipients, ref subject,
ref showMessage);
}
Разрешения
- Полное доверие для непосредственно вызывающего метода. Этот член не может быть использован частично доверенным кодом. Дополнительные сведения см. в разделе Использование библиотек из не вполне надежного кода.